Transaction 28e9edef62705ac2f2112673aec15141cc3084649fcfc150a2c5234bc3151716
1 Input
1 Output
-
28e9edef62705ac2f2112673aec15141cc3084649fcfc150a2c5234bc3151716:0
- value
- 3999630
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 70d64c0b68d8bc4604ae7339ad65e3bad4bda25c74916815560eb12e27860718
- address
- bc1pwrtyczmgmz7yvp9wwvu66e0rht2tmgjuwjgks92kp6cjufuxquvqcna0h0